Information about Islam has never been easier to find, and never harder to check. A question that once meant asking a scholar now returns ten thousand answers, of which some are sound, many are careless, and a proportion are actively misleading.

This book is a response to that.

What It Sets Out

The essential principles of Islam as they are established in the Noble Quran and the authentic teachings of the Prophet Muhammad ﷺ — presented directly, with the evidence attached, so a reader can see where a position comes from rather than being asked to accept it.

The Principle Behind It

Its title is its argument. Belief is not something to be assembled from custom, from what a community happens to practice, or from whatever explanation was most persuasive the last time the subject came up. It is taken from two sources, and a Muslim who knows which two can evaluate everything else.

That skill is the real subject of the book. A reader who finishes it is better equipped not because he has memorized a hundred rulings, but because he now asks a different question when he meets a claim: where is this from?

Who It Is For

Muslims at any level who want their beliefs on firm ground. New Muslims meeting conflicting accounts of their own religion. Anyone with an interest in Islamic thought who wants a dependable starting point.
